In a pre-dawn tweet, J&K’s top bureaucrat says CEO Anantnag is being put under suspension | KNO

Srinagar, May 20 (KNO) :The Jammu and Kashmir government on Wednesday announced that Chief Education Officer Anantnag is being put under suspension. As per KNO, in a pre-dawn tweet, administrative secretary School Education department, Asgar Samoon announced that CEO Anantnag is being put under suspension. “Shocked to know; middle school monghal Ang has 15 teachers & 13 students; those who don’t teach don’t deserve mercy; Directors to explain why teacher deployments not rationalised despite directions of HLG; CEO Ang being placed under suspension for others to follow or face action,” Samoon tweeted at 4: 58 am—(KNO)
